Block walls serve both practical and visual functions in landscaping, offering structure, privacy, and visual interest to outside areas. These walls can be used to maintain soil on sloped properties, define garden beds, or develop clear borders within a landscape. The choice of block type-- concrete, interlocking, or ornamental-- impacts both the strength and appearance of the wall. Correct preparation makes sure stability, particularly for taller walls, with considerations for drain, support, and soil pressure. Installation begins with a well-prepared base, often involving excavation and leveling to make sure the wall stays straight and steady with time. Mortar or adhesive might be used depending on the block type, and reinforcement like rebar can improve durability. A knowledgeable landscaper makes sure each course is level and lined up, avoiding future moving or splitting. Block walls likewise provide creative chances through finishes, textures, and colors, allowing them to complement the surrounding landscape. Incorporating lighting, planters, or cascading plants can soften the hard edges, making the wall both useful and aesthetically enticing. Regular examinations and minor repair work help keep the wall's stability for many years to come
